ATN's Tribute to 100 Years of Indian Cinema season 4 episode 3, titled "Om Puri: Part 3 - ATN's Tribute to 100 Years of Indian Cinema," continues to pay homage to the legendary actor Om Puri and his exceptional contributions to the Indian film industry. This episode delves deeper into Om Puri's illustrious career, shining a spotlight on some of his most iconic roles and exploring the impact he left on Indian cinema.
In this installment, viewers are taken on a captivating journey through Om Puri's cinematic milestones, beginning with his early days in the industry. The episode traces his incredible rise to fame, from his initial struggles to his breakthrough performances that established him as a force to be reckoned with in Bollywood.
With a career spanning over four decades, Om Puri left an indelible mark on Indian cinema with his exceptional acting prowess and versatility. This episode sheds light on his wide range of roles, showcasing his ability to seamlessly transition between intense dramas, thought-provoking art-house films, and light-hearted comedies. From his memorable portrayal of a police officer in "Aakrosh" to his critically acclaimed performance in "Ardh Satya," Om Puri's talent for capturing the essence of each character he portrayed is explored in depth.
Furthermore, the episode provides a glimpse into Om Puri's collaborations with some of the most brilliant minds in Indian cinema. It delves into his partnerships with renowned directors like Govind Nihalani, Shyam Benegal, and Satyajit Ray, exploring the creative synergy that resulted in some of the most impactful films of his career.
In addition to his phenomenal work in the Hindi film industry, the episode also acknowledges Om Puri's international success and his foray into Western cinema. It highlights his remarkable performances in acclaimed movies such as "The Jewel in the Crown," "East Is East," and "City of Joy," which earned him accolades and widespread recognition beyond the Indian borders.
Apart from his acting skills, Om Puri's commitment to societal issues and his deep understanding of human emotions are also highlighted in this episode. It showcases his dedication to socially relevant cinema, where he tackled subjects like corruption, caste discrimination, and political unrest. His seamless portrayal of complex characters in movies such as "Maqbool" and "Ankur" not only entertained but also left a lasting impact on audiences, amplifying his reputation as a profoundly talented actor.
